#24252e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#24252e is composed of 14.1% red, 14.5%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.7% cyan, 19.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 234 degrees, a saturation of 12.2% and a lightness of 16.1%. #24252e color hex could be obtained by blending #484a5c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#24252e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f6f6f8 is the lightest one.
